Iñaki Iturria is a scholar working on Cell Biology, Molecular Biology and Food Science. According to data from OpenAlex, Iñaki Iturria has authored 10 papers receiving a total of 590 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Cell Biology, 4 papers in Molecular Biology and 4 papers in Food Science. Recurrent topics in Iñaki Iturria's work include Zebrafish Biomedical Research Applications (5 papers), Probiotics and Fermented Foods (4 papers) and Aquaculture disease management and microbiota (3 papers). Iñaki Iturria is often cited by papers focused on Zebrafish Biomedical Research Applications (5 papers), Probiotics and Fermented Foods (4 papers) and Aquaculture disease management and microbiota (3 papers). Iñaki Iturria collaborates with scholars based in Spain, Switzerland and Algeria. Iñaki Iturria's co-authors include Isaac Adatto, Joshua T. Gamse, Arantza Muriana, Jennifer L. Freeman, Steven Van Cruchten, Randall T. Peterson, Steven Cassar, Leonard I. Zon, Christian Lawrence and Miguel Ángel Pardo and has published in prestigious journals such as International Journal of Molecular Sciences, Carbohydrate Polymers and Applied Microbiology and Biotechnology.
